I'm wondering now how the heck did my DLL get loaded into explorer... Any Plus wizards know the details of how scripts are loaded?
I'm just guessing (I'm no wizard), but isn't it Explorer which controls the taskbar and system tray? (Kill all explorer processes and you'll see you're desktop and taskbar being removed).
As such, manipulating the system tray is actually manipulating Explorer's memory space/process (maybe not technically correct, but for the lack of better explaination). And if you make an error in that space (eg: reading/writing to a memory page which is locked), Explorer will crash.
